    摘要: An optical touch apparatus is disclosed. The optical touch apparatus comprises a light source emitting module, an optical module, a light sensing module, and a processing module. The optical module and the light sensing module are set around a surface of the optical touch apparatus. The light source emitting module sequentially emits scanning lights uniformly distributed above a direct scanned region of the surface according to a time sequence. When an object forms a touch point on the surface, the object will block the scanning lights and reflected lights reflected by the optical module. The light sensing module generates a sensing result according to the condition the light sensing module receives the scanning lights and the reflected lights. The processing module determines the position of the touch point according to the time sequence and the sensing result.

    摘要: An optical touch apparatus is disclosed. The optical touch apparatus comprises a light emitting module, a noise suppressing module, a light sensing module, and a processing module. The light emitting module emits at least one sensing beam, and the at least one sensing beam comprises a plurality of sensing rays. If an emitting angle of a specific sensing ray among the plurality of sensing rays toward a light sensor of the light sensing module is larger than a default value, the noise suppressing module will block the specific sensing ray from emitting into the light sensor. After the light sensing module generates a sensing result according to the condition of the light sensing module receiving the at least one sensing beam, the processing module will determine the position of a touch point according to the sensing result.

    摘要: An apparatus and a method for changing optical tweezers are provided. The apparatus includes a diffractive optical element (DOE), a mask unit and an objective lens. The DOE includes a plurality of phase delay patterns. The mask unit includes a plurality of mask patterns that correspond to the phase delay patterns, respectively, wherein at least a portion of the mask patterns are complementary. A laser beam passing through each phase diffractive pattern correspondingly passes through each mask pattern to generate a compound diffractive pattern. The objective lens receives the compound diffractive pattern and focuses it on an examining object to form an optical tweezers.

    摘要: The invention discloses a device for animating facial expression. The device includes at least one resilient member and at least one actuator. The resilient member is regarded as a facial feature on a face, and the resilient member has a first end and a second end. The first end of the resilient member is rotatably and/or movably attached onto the face. The actuator is used for actuating the first end of the resilient member to rotate, so that the facial feature is capable of exhibiting various facial expressions on the face, wherein the facial feature can be eyebrow, upper eyelid, lower eyelid, upper lip or lower lip.

    摘要: The present invention provides an optical disk and, more particularly, an optical disk including a data side and a label side. The data side has a first pregroove on which a plurality of first position marks are marked to provide an optical pickup unit with a basis for writing data onto the data side or reading data from the data side. In addition, the label side has a label layer and a second pregroove on which a plurality of second position marks are marked to provide the optical pickup unit with a basis for forming an image onto the label side.

    摘要: The invention provides a microinjection apparatus for a fluid. The microinjection apparatus includes a substrate, a manifold, a fluid chamber, a dummy chamber, a detecting device, and a pair of parallel conductive plates. The manifold is formed on the substrate and supplies the fluid chamber and the dummy chamber, also formed on the substrate, with the fluid. In addition, the pair of parallel conductive plates are formed on a pair of opposite inner walls of the dummy chamber, and electrically connected to the detecting device. By applying the pair of parallel conductive plates and the detecting device provided in the invention, the size of the fluid chamber and the fluid-filled condition relative to the fluid chamber can be indirectly detected by non-destructive testing. Furthermore, the cost of and the time of testing also can be prominently saved.

    摘要: The present invention is directed to a procedure and a special balloon used in balloon angioplasty and stent installation in percutaneous transluminal coronary angioplasty (PTCA), which employs a heart catheter with a balloon at its distal end. After being inflated, the balloon is in doughnut shape with a hole in the center; its length is made to fit the length of the stent to be inflated. During an angioplasty procedure, the balloon is pushed forward into the stenosis and inflated with a device to dilate the blockage. The doughnut_shaped balloon provides a pass way for blood to flow through the coronary artery vessel, which does not cause angina akin to a heart attack resulted from traditional tube_shaped balloons used in the PTCA procedure that completely block blood flow after being fully inflated during balloon angioplasty and stent installation.

    摘要: The present invention provides a method for recording an image onto a label layer of an optical disc by a laser beam. First, the method of the invention divides the label layer into a plurality of unit regions. For each of the unit regions, the method of the invention determines a recording pattern corresponding to each unit region in accordance with the data related to the image to be recorded. Finally, the method of the invention controls the laser beam to irradiate a relative energy on each unit region, so as to form the corresponding recording pattern. Thereby, the whole of the recording patterns formed on the label layer exhibits the image.

    摘要: Electro-optical communications may be facilitated between electrical devices by providing pluggable electro-optic modules. The pluggable electro-optic modules may be pluggingly received within U-shaped electrical connectors associated with printed circuit boards on both the receive and transmit ends. In some cases, the pluggable modules may be plugged in to establish communications and may be removed for repair or replacement.
